MV-90, Power Cable, 5 KV, 3/C, Cu/XLPE/CTS/PVC (ICEA S-93-639/NEMA WC71/UL 1072)

Features
UL Listed as MV-90. Rated as Sunlight Resistance for CT use, 1/0 AWG and larger. Oil Resistance I jacket. True Triple extrusion system and closed handling raw materials system, to eliminate any contact with ambient, until extrusion process ends.
Application
Primary power and distribution circuits in industrial and commercial installations, power circuits in generating plants where line to ground fault current are within shield capabilities. May be used in wet or dry locations, installed in raceways, duct, and open air, aerially or directly buried where permitted by NEC.
Standards
UL 1072: Medium Voltage Power Cables.
ICEA S-93-639/NEMA WC74: 5 kV - 46 kV Shielded Power Cables.
ICEA S-97-682: Standard for Utility Shielded Power Cables Rated 5 kV- 46 kV.
AEIC CS8: Specification for Extruded Dielectric, Shielded Power Cables Rated 5 kV - 46 kV.
Specifications
Maximum operating voltage: 5 kV to 35 kV 100% and 133% IL
Maximum conductor operation temperatures:
Wet and dry locations: Normal: 90 °C, Emergency: 130 °C, Short Circuit: 250 °C
Engineering Information
1. Conductor: Soft annealed uncoated copper compacted Class B per ASTM B496 or hard drawn Aluminum-1350 compacted Class B per ASTM B400.
2. Conductor Shield: Semi conducting cross-linked polyethylene (XLPE).
3. Insulation: Thermoset crosslinked polyethylene (XLPE).
4. Insulation Shield: Semi conducting cross-linked polyethylene (XLPE).
5. Metallic Shield: Soft annealed uncoated copper tape, 5 mil thick, 25% minimum overlap.
6. Assembly: Conductors cabled with non-hygroscopic fillers, as required and binder tape.
7. Jacket: Black sunlight resistance and flame retardant thermoplastic polyvinyl chloride (PVC) compound.
